Right, I'm trying to make some civ specific scientific advancements using a hacked editor downloaded from this site.
It sounds a bit complicated, but I want one civ to have a unique improvement and a unique government that only it can research. I've flagged this improvement so that it needs this specific government as a required pre requesite.
The Help box in the editor hinted that attatching 'none' as the era of an advancement (as opposed to 'ancient', 'modern, etc), then it could never be researched, but could be given as a free tech to a civ at the start of the game.
I flagged this advancement to one of my civs and played the game but it did not register the advancement as being gained. I even flagged pottery as 'none' and gave it as free but it still didn't register.
Question; The editor said that this would work, but it hasn't. Is it,
A: My fault
B: A mistake by Firaxis, or a bug
C: A compatibility problem. I'm playing an unpatched game, using the hacked 1.16 editor. However I've managed to add extra units with no trouble, as well as alter existing rules. I've also usid this editor with my 1.17 patched game with no trouble.
Please help!
